Welcome to Betania, a project that began in 2009 as a dream, with hardly any resources or experience in business, when I started helping vulnerable groups in La Línea de la Concepción and became a ‘human civil engineer’.

 

I see social intervention as a profoundly human and strategic endeavour. Without superficial fixes or shortcuts. Every person has a unique story that deserves to be understood in all its complexity: their context, their life journey and all the factors that influence their reality. Every situation has a root cause from which to intervene in order to achieve structural changes that truly transform lives, break cycles of vulnerability and open up new opportunities.

 

Being a human pathways engineer means equipping people with tools, strengthening their capacities and creating the necessary conditions for each individual to regain their autonomy and dignity and move confidently towards their own future. It is a profound process that requires time, commitment and conscious intervention that leaves a real and lasting impact. This is what we believe in every day and what we work towards at Betania.

We work in line with the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s)

The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) represent the cornerstones for eradicating poverty, preserving the environment and ensuring that everyone enjoys peace and prosperity.


At Betania, we are committed to working in line with these SDGs, implementing solutions to combat poverty and hunger, and developing projects that promote improved health and well-being for those who use our services. We are committed to personal and professional growth, as well as quality education, with the aim of reducing inequalities in all their forms.

Advisory Board

The role on Betania’s Advisory Board involves, as its primary responsibility, proposing, analysing, evaluating and recommending projects and programmes to Betania’s Board of Directors. These duties are designed to contribute to the organisation’s development and improvement, ensuring that decisions taken are based on a thorough analysis and on the fulfilment of established objectives.
